An online talk about the Australian programs on coral reef adaptation and
restoration.
https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=mAuthqJBuAw&t=24s
This part of the talk begins at about minute 35.
Australia has a huge program, largest in the world, lots of research, much
of it working on practical matters of how to do things and solving
problems. They have at least 300 people working on this in about a dozen
or so institutions. The presentation also tells you where to go online to
learn more about their programs.

Scientists size up human predatory footprint
Humans are the ultimate predators, trapping, hunting, or otherwise
exploiting 15,000 species of vertebrates—300 times more species than
jaguars and 113 times more than great white sharks.
